Start with soil. Much of Charlotte rests on hefty red clay that compacts quickly. If you've ever before tried to grow a Japanese maple without changing the soil, you have actually most likely seen it struggle. A competent landscape contractor comprehends exactly how to loosen up and amend clay with garden compost, when to elevate beds, and exactly how to avoid producing a tub impact around plant roots. On several projects, we have actually made use of a two-layer approach: loosen the top 8 to 10 inches, then integrate 2 to 3 inches of garden compost and great pine bark, complied with by a great compost that won't mat. The outcome is fewer drainage grievances and better rooting.
Drainage is the 2nd column. Charlotte's summer season tornados can dispose an inch of rainfall in under an hour. A landscaping company that understands the city's slopes and regular whole lot grading will certainly suggest subtle grading, French drains where required, and catch containers at downspout electrical outlets. Great water drainage work shows up on the following storm day. Water should relocate where it belongs, not pond near the structure or produce sloppy ruts along footpaths.
Third, plant option. Our heat index and moisture push plants hard. The standouts for framework and integrity include hollies, distylium, dwarf yaupon, and hard hydrangeas like 'Spotlight' that can take care of sun if irrigated appropriately. Crepe myrtles do well, though they need space to avoid covering. For groundcovers, consider mondo yard, liriope, and ajuga in partial shade. Grass decisions are a base test for a landscaping company's local experience. In Charlotte, warm-season turfs like Bermuda and zoysia prosper completely sun and heat. High fescue stays prominent for shade tolerance and color via spring and loss, however needs overseeding each fall and mindful irrigation to make it through July. If a landscaper neglects these compromises, keep interviewing.

Price per square foot can be deceptive. A paver patio may range commonly depending upon base preparation, access, side restriction, and option of material. A standard 300-square-foot patio in Charlotte could begin in the low 4 numbers for spending plan pavers and uncomplicated gain access to, yet a premium rock, complex pattern, or limited backyard gain access to that calls for hand-carrying will press the number higher. Excellent estimators in this market break out line products and suggest whether prices is allowance-based, fixed, or subject to website conditions.
When a bid looks a lot less than others, inspect the base. Hardscapes in clay soil require a secure base and compaction to stay clear of heaving. If the service provider is stinting excavation deepness or aggregate, you will certainly pay for fixings later on. The very same reasoning relates to turf setup. Turf prices fluctuate, yet the large variable is preparation. Freshly laid turf over compressed clay with minimal grading will look penalty for a month, then battle. Proper soil preparation includes expense however saves watering and reseeding over the next couple of seasons.
Maintenance propositions deserve scrutiny also. Weekly mowing could be quoted cheaply, but if it doesn't consist of bed bordering, weed monitoring, and seasonal trimming, you will certainly either deal with an unkempt look or pay piecemeal. Ask for a 12-month upkeep plan with licensed landscape contractor Charlotte clear seasonal tasks: spring bed prep, pre-emergent in beds and turf, summer season pruning schedules for details hedges, fall oygenation and overseeding for fescue, winter months lowerings and compost refresh.
Charlotte's landscape rhythm works on a predictable cycle, yet timing is every little thing. Oygenation and overseeding of tall fescue must strike a home window in late September through October when soil is cozy but evenings cool. Warm-season yards like Bermuda get scalp and pre-emergent therapy earlier in springtime. Hedge pruning depends upon flower time. Cut azaleas and camellias right after they bloom, not in Charlotte lawn care landscapers late summer season when they establish buds for next year. Crepe myrtles demand discerning trimming, not topping, to stay clear of weak development and knuckles that invite disease.
Irrigation adjustments often separate average landscapers from the very best. July and August require deeper, much less frequent watering to train roots and control fungi. A proficient landscape contractor Charlotte property owners count on will change zones and series seasonally, validate uniform protection, and look for overspray onto hardscapes that wastes water and discolorations. Where house owners have actually sloped yards, we usually program cycle-and-soak routines to lower runoff.
Mulch is another Charlotte certain. Shredded wood prevails, but in pine-heavy communities, a yearn straw top layer mixes far better visually and remains oxygenated. Mulch deepness must be two to three inches, and it should be pulled back from trunks and stems. Twice every year, I see beds where mulch volcanoes choke trees. A great landscaping service trains staffs to feather mulch, not stack it.
Charlotte homes vary from block traditionals to modern-day builds with high drives and limited side backyards. The most effective designs honor the architecture and resolve issues like screening, water drainage, and outdoor living. For personal privacy along residential or commercial property lines, I choose a mixed bush rather than a monoculture. Mix columnar hollies, anise, and tea olive so one bug can't take the entire screen. For warm front yards, decorative grasses like miscanthus or muhly include movement without requiring continuous trimming. On the color side, layers of ferns, hellebores, and hostas under cover oaks offer four-season structure.
Common missteps consist of installing thirsty plants without watering or picking sun-loving hedges for the north side of your home. An additional chronic blunder is positioning trees also near the structure. Maintain small decorative trees at least 8 to 10 feet away, bigger cover trees much farther. For outdoor patios, pick shades that complement red and tan block prevalent in Charlotte. Trendy grey pavers can look raw against cozy brick, so we typically present a blended paver with buff and charcoal flecks or add a soldier training course in a warmer tone.
Lighting includes functional hours in springtime and loss. A thoughtful lights plan highlights form, not wattage. We uplight sampling trees, downlight from eaves for soft wash on outdoor patios, and keep path lights spaced large to stay clear of a runway look. Low-voltage LED systems with stainless or sturdy brass components stand up in humidity and thunderstorms.
When you narrow your options, placed proposals side-by-side and focus on three things: scope clarity, materials, and oversight. An in-depth scope listings plant sizes by container or caliper, not just types. It describes base deepness for hardscapes and consists of compaction standards. It specifies irrigation head kinds and controller design. When one bid claims "mount shrubs" and another lists 5 3-gallon distylium, six 5-gallon hollies, and the specific mulch amount, you understand which one establishes far better expectations.
Materials matter in Charlotte's warm and sunlight. Ask about turf varieties by name. For Bermuda, preferred options consist of Tifway 419 or more recent cultivars that take care of shade slightly better, though Bermuda still wants full sunlight. For zoysia, cultivars like Zenith or Geo have various appearance and growth habits. If you pick high fescue, look for a mix with disease-resistant selections and ask for seed tags. Compost type need to be residential landscaping company specified. For hardscapes, verify paver brand and collection, polymeric sand type, and whether they consist of a breathable sealant.

Be cautious if a company presses landscape material under compost as a magic bullet for weeds. In Charlotte's clay, material usually catches wetness, causes anaerobic problems, and doesn't stop windblown seeds from rooting in the mulch on top. Another red flag is a one-size-fits-all irrigation design that sprays big grass zones throughout blended sun and shade. You will either overwater the sun or sink the color. Zoning that fits direct exposure and plant requirements is the mark of a thoughtful installer.
Watch the calendar. If a landscaper suggests significant plant installation in the optimal of summer season without a watering strategy and guarantee conditions, press time out. Spring and autumn are much more flexible for growing right here. Summertime installments can work, yet they require stringent irrigation and compost protection.
Even the most effective layout fails without care. A strong upkeep program in Charlotte includes regular or twice monthly visits throughout the growing season, with trimming elevations readjusted for turf kind. Bermuda and zoysia desire shorter cuts, while fescue ought to stay higher, especially in warm, to shade origins and minimize stress and anxiety. Edging maintains lines tidy however must avoid scalping along driveways where irrigation coverage is light.
Pruning is a lot more nuanced than it looks. Numerous foundation shrubs respond best to discerning hand trimming as opposed to shearing. Shears create an environment-friendly shell and woody inside that restricts air flow, which encourages condition in our moisture. If your landscaping service makes use of power shears for every little thing, ask exactly how they manage careful cuts on hollies, abelia, and hydrangeas that flower on brand-new wood versus old timber. Excellent crews track bloom times and adjust.
Fertilization and weed control vary by lawn. Warm-season lawns need feedings in late spring and summer, then a downturn as they come close to dormancy. Fescue appreciates a fall-heavy approach and lighter summer inputs to reduce fungus stress. Pre-emergents in early springtime and fall aid, however just when coupled with proper mowing elevations and watering. A landscape contractor who manages both setup and upkeep will certainly have a schedule customized to Charlotte, not a generic schedule from an additional zone.

Most homes gain from three targeted investments that don't require a full overhaul. First, fix drain wherever water gathers near your home or along high-use courses. A few well-placed basins or an increased bed can alter a soggy edge right into a useful room. Second, pick a turf approach aligned with sunlight direct exposure. If majority of your yard stays in shade, fescue with annual overseeding may defeat a consistent fight to keep Bermuda active. If you have open sun, Bermuda or zoysia will lower summertime watering and remain tougher under foot website traffic. Third, upgrade structure beds with long lasting, region-appropriate hedges and a two-tier compost approach that maintains roots cool down. These 3 steps often provide an immediate boost in aesthetic appeal and lasting reductions in maintenance calls.

A professional landscaping service Charlotte homeowners trust will certainly provide a composed agreement with scope, routine, repayment turning points, and service warranty terms. Plant warranties often run one year if the professional sets up and the homeowner preserves watering according to guidelines. Hardscape warranties vary, but you need to see at least a year on craftsmanship. Read exemptions very closely. If you deal with watering or alter grades after setup, you might invalidate insurance coverage. Respectable landscapers document pre-existing problems and take images prior to and after to avoid disputes.
It's reasonable to request for a strike list walk-through before last settlement. Bring plans or the proposal to verify quantities and positionings. Check irrigation protection utilizing catch cups or a quick visual test to make sure all areas run and no heads are buried or splashing fences. Stroll the hardscape barefoot to really feel for shaking pavers. Inspect lighting at sunset to guarantee also coverage and proper fixture aim.
Not every task belongs with a maintenance-first landscaping company. If your job includes considerable grading, a preserving wall surface over 4 feet, drain linkups, or structures like pergolas and exterior kitchens, employ a landscape contractor with engineering capabilities and permitting experience. In older Charlotte communities with mature trees, huge origins near prepared hardscapes require specialized methods and often arborist examination. Specialists made use of to these constraints will safeguard root areas, make use of air spades where necessary, and adjust layouts to preserve tree health.
For watering, a certified installer that comprehends Charlotte Water's heartburn requirements will save migraines. If you are adding low-voltage lighting, seek service providers who size transformers suitably, equilibrium tons on runs, and use leak-proof connectors that sustain our heavy rains.

The 3/4/5 method is a layout technique used to create square corners.
Measuring 3 units on one side, 4 on the other, and 5 diagonally confirms a right angle.
It is based on the Pythagorean theorem.
